Cisco Deploys Foundation-Sec-1.1 For Identity Security
Cisco announced Tuesday it is using an 8-billion-parameter instruction-tuned model, Foundation-Sec-1.1-8B-Instruct, to power Duo Identity Intelligence. The Llama-3.1-8B-based model is tuned for cybersecurity tasks like triage, threat modeling, vulnerability prioritization and identity-behavior analysis, and will produce clearer weekly identity digests for over 2,000 customers. The model can run on-premises or in the cloud and supports broader security automation.
